Stopping Acceleration and Deceleration (Accel/Decel Ramp Hold)

The accel/decel ramp hold function stops acceleration and deceleration, stores the output frequency at that
point in time, and then continues operation.

Set one of the parameters H1-01 to H1-10 (Terminal S3 to S12 Function Selection) to A (accel/decel ramp
hold) to stop acceleration and deceleration when the terminal is turned on and to store the output frequency at
that point in time. Acceleration and deceleration will restart when the terminal is turned off.

If d4-01 is set to 1 and the Accel/Decel Ramp Hold Command is input, the output frequency is still stored
even after the power supply is turned off.
